Upcoming Android Phones 2014: Leaked Photos Showcase Huawei's Super Thin Ascend P7, Boasts 5" 1080p Display, 13MP Shooter, 8MP Front Cam

A couple of days ago, we saw an alleged spec sheet of one of the many upcoming Android phones for 2014. Now, we see what appears to be the real thing. 

In a report by GSM Arena, a live of the photo of the Huawei Ascend P7 surfaced, providing us a little bit more information about the upcoming Android handset. 

From what we can see, the smartphone gets a similar design to its older sibling the Ascend P6. 

Aesthetics aside, the Huawei-developed handset boasts quality specs. It packs a 5-inch Full HD (1920 x 1080) resolution display, a HiSilicon 910 chipset, a 13-megapixel primary camera, an 8MP front facing cam, and a battery capacity of 2,460mAh battery. 

Knowing Huawei and the highly competitive Chinese market, this Android-powered device would surely have an affordable price tag, probably between $200-300.
